Quantity Delivered definition

Quantity Delivered means the quantity of LNG, expressed in MMBtu, actually delivered under a Transaction for an LNG Cargo, as determined in accordance with Clause 10.3;
Quantity Delivered means the quantity of energy expressed in MMBtu contained in a cargo of LNG unloaded under a Specific Order as per the EX-SHIP Certificate of Volume on Unloading and the EX-SHIP Certificate of Quality on Unloading.
Quantity Delivered means the number of MMBtu contained in an LNG Cargo unloaded under a specific Confirmation Notice issued under this Agreement, calculated in accordance with Annex B. More Definitions of Quantity Delivered

Quantity Delivered means, with respect to a given Cargo, the quantity of LNG, expressed in MMBtu, delivered by Supplier to Buyer from such Cargo at the Delivery Point, as determined pursuant to §7 and Exhibit B.
Quantity Delivered means the quantity of LNG expressed in MMBtu in any cargo actually delivered by the Customer and taken by PLL at the LNG Receipt Point, as determined in accordance with Schedule 5 (LNG Measurement, Sampling and Testing).
Quantity Delivered means the number of MMBTU contained in a cargo of LNG delivered by Seller to Buyer hereunder, determined in accordance with the provisions of Article 6 and Annexure C.
Quantity Delivered means the total net LNG, expressed in MMBtu and m3, actually delivered by the Customer from the LNG Cargo (subject to operational tolerance of +/- 5%), and taken by PLL at the Receiving Facilities, as determined in accordance with Schedule 5 (LNG Measurement, Sampling and Testing).
